Access Denied

You don't have permission to access "http://info.taiwantrade.com/biznews/2017%E5%B9%B4%E5%8D%B0%E5%B0%BC%E8%87%BA%E7%81%A3%E5%BD%A2%E8%B1%A1%E5%B1%95-%E6%94%AC%E6%89%8D%E5%AA%92%E5%90%88%E5%8D%80-%E5%8D%94%E5%8A%A9%E4%BC%81%E6%A5%AD%E5%BB%B6%E6%94%AC%E5%8D%B0%E5%B0%BC%E4%BA%BA%E6%89%8D-1287827.html" on this server.

Reference #18.6d73017.1711641909.1738863

https://errors.edgesuite.net/18.6d73017.1711641909.1738863